About Thankful Brainard

MAYFLOWER DESCENDANT & DAR MATRON OF THE AMERICAN REVOLUTION - Mayflower descendant - her 2ggrandfather was Edward Fuller. She was the 2nd wife of American Revolution veteran Abijah Brainerd -tcd



http://freepages.genealogy.rootsweb.com/~dav4is/ODTs/BRAINERD.shtml


Abijah married Thankful Fuller in May 1738. Together they had 10 children:

Abijah Brainerd Mary Brainard Asaph Brainerd Cornelius Brainerd Dorcas Brainerd Noah Brainerd Rachel Brainerd Shubal Brainerd Thankful Brainerd Urijah Brainerd
